Establish absolute oversight and regain command over your autonomous local AI fleets without sacrificing privacy or incurring cloud costs.

Running autonomous agents locally offers privacy, but many developers report high anxiety over "ghost" processes that consume resources or deviate from parameters, forcing them to babysit the terminal and preventing true unattended operation.

This 'Mission Control' Docker stack acts as a transparent proxy between your agent logic and the local inference engine, intercepting all traffic to provide a centralized layer of security. It captures every API call, renders a real-time visual stream of agent "thought chains," and provides a panic-button interface to terminate rogue tasks instantly, ensuring your agents remain productive and compliant even when you are away from the keyboard.

What's included:

  • Agent Supervisor Container (Docker Compose) -- Deploys a standalone, isolated environment that manages agent lifecycles without disrupting your existing development setup.
  • API Interception Middleware (Python) -- Captures and logs every raw JSON request and response from local engines, allowing you to inspect exactly what data your agents send and receive.
  • Real-time Telemetry UI (Lightweight React) -- Provides a low-latency, single-page dashboard to visualize prompt/response pairs and monitor system health in real-time.
  • Automated Markdown Auditor -- Generates timestamped, human-readable logs of all token usage and decision paths for compliance checks and post-mortem debugging.
  • Universal Agent Integration Scripts -- Includes pre-written connectors for popular frameworks like Odysseus and DeepSeek, slashing setup time to minutes.
